R L Glendenning Roofing
Renovation · Roof construction
1081 3rd St, 15137 North VersaillesRenovation · Roof construction
1081 3rd St, 15137 North VersaillesRenovation · Roof construction
5109 Clairton Blvd, 15236 PittsburghRenovation · Roof construction
1070 Clifton Rd, 15102 Bethel Park